Predictions Methodology

The Portuguese Liga (Primeira Liga) consists of 18 teams. As with many other European leagues, teams progress throughout the season using the process of promotion and relegation, with the two lowest teams relegated to Segunda Liga, and the two highest teams moving up to join the Primeira Liga. The league became official in 1938, after four years as an experimental league, and has since improved its reputation within the UEFA (Union of European Football Associations).
